- 博客(7)
- 收藏
- 关注
原创 spring事务
Spring在不同的事务管理API之上定义了一个抽象层,使得开发人员不必了解底层的事务管理API就可以使用Spring的事务管理机制。Spring支持编程式事务管理和声明式的事务管理。编程式事务管理 将事务管理代码嵌到业务方法中来控制事务的提交和回滚 缺点:必须在每个事务操作业务逻辑中包含额外的事务管理代码声明式事务管理(一般情况下比编程式事务好用) 将事务管理代码从业务方法中分离出来,以声明的方式来实现事务管理。 将事务管理作为横切关注点,通过aop方法模块化。Spring中
2021-01-18 10:01:22 53
原创 MyBatis-Spring
1、导入相关jar包junit<dependency> <groupId>junit</groupId> <artifactId>junit</artifactId> <version>4.12</version></dependency>mybatis<dependency> <groupId>org.mybatis</groupId>
2021-01-18 09:52:04 79
原创 AOP
【重点】使用AOP织入,需要导入一个依赖包!<!-- https://mvnrepository.com/artifact/org.aspectj/aspectjweaver --><dependency> <groupId>org.aspectj</groupId> <artifactId>aspectjweaver</artifactId> <version>1.9.4</version>
2021-01-18 09:41:32 51
原创 spring注解注入,b站尚硅谷Spring5idea
ioc操作bean管理(基于注解方式)1.什么是注解(1)注解是代码特殊标记,格式:@注解名称(属性名称=属性值,属性名称=属性值。。。。。)(2)使用注解,注解在类的上面,方法上面,属性上面(3)使用注解的目的:简化xml配置2.Bean管理中创建对象提供注解(1)@Component 普通组件(2)@Service 业务逻辑层(3)@Controller web层(4)@Repository dao层*上面四个注解功能是一样的,都可以用来创建bean实例3.基于注解方
2021-01-01 19:13:41 94
原创 IOC自学笔记,b站尚硅谷Spring5idea
1. 什么是IOC(1)控制反转,把对象的创建和对象之间调用的过程,交给Spring进行管理 (2)降低代码之间的耦合度。2. IOC底层原理xml的解析,工厂模式,反射3. IOC底层原理(1)xml配置文件,配置创建的对象(2)<bean id="xx" class="xx.xxx.xxx.xxx"></bean>(3) 。。。。。。4. IOC接口1.IOC是想基于IOC容器完成,IOC容器底层是对象工厂2.Spring提供IOC容器实现两种方式(两个接
2020-12-10 11:37:03 118
原创 Eclipse的快捷键添加到idea中
添加自定义的快捷键.jar文件File——>import settings。导入.jar文件点击ok更换快捷键仅供自己使用的快捷键。1 如何查看源码 (class) ctrl + 选中指定的结构 或 ctrl + shift + t2 万能解错/生成返回值变量 alt + enter3 查看继承关系(type hierarchy) F44 提示方法参数类型(Parameter Info) ctrl+alt+/5 大写转小写/小写转大写(toggl
2020-10-06 23:02:59 443
原创 java 内存的小知识点
内存中的划分int类型为4个字节char类型为1个字节所以一般情况 在定义byte(1个字节)占内存的4个字节。为节省空间,可将4个byte捆绑byte a;byte b;byte c;byte d;同样占用4个字节byte a;int z;byte b;byte c;byte d;占用8个字节。如有问题,请大家纠正,谢谢大家。...
2020-09-26 09:10:58 46
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人